Chapter five hundred and ninety-three

The setting sun hung on Maple Leaf Mountain.

There is a night wind.

Xiahou Zhuo suddenly shuddered, feeling a little cold.

He looked at Ning Chuchu, grinned, and actually stepped off the chariot, without taking the knife he had hung on the chariot that had been with him for many years.

He stood about ten feet away from Ning Chuchu.

He bowed respectfully, and his dark face actually showed a look of love at this moment.

"Your Highness, we haven't seen you for ten years!"

"His Royal Highness has grown up. Seeing him is as if the empress is here in person. This old slave is very relieved."

After saying these few words, Xia Houzhuo seemed to have suddenly aged.

His face no longer looked as strong and courageous as when he was conquering all directions. His face now looked a little decadent, a little lost, and a little bit seemed to be relieved.

Ning Chuchu is kind-hearted after all.

She seemed to be reminded of her childhood.

When Xia Houzhuo returned to Beijing to report on his duties, his mother had already passed away.

In the East Palace of the prince brother, he knelt down and swore to the prince brother that he would ensure that the prince brother ascended the throne and became the emperor!

This is his belief.

He did not change because of his mother's death.

He firmly grasped the military power of the western frontier army and has been trying his best to build momentum for the prince brother.

Even in order for the crown prince brother to keep the pressure on the second emperor brother, he gave up Jiuyin City despite the infamy, causing Jiuyin City to fall into the hands of the deserters.

He originally thought that if his father could agree to the crown prince's brother's personal expedition, he would definitely assist the prince's brother in retaking Jiuyin City and give him a great military merit.

However, my father never came back from Changle Palace.

The Jitai family in the court held great power and did not send the prince's brother's request to his father.

He could only hold on to the northern frontier troops and look at the lost Jiuyin City in the distance.

He gave up leading his troops to recapture Jiuyin City because it would cause heavy losses to his troops.

He can't have enough soldiers!

He hoped that with the soldiers in his hands, Ji Tai and others would be afraid.

His purpose was somewhat effective, and the prince's brother was relatively stable during those years in the East Palace.

Of course, it may be that the generosity and harmlessness shown by the prince's brother in the East Palace did not directly infringe on the interests of Ji Tai and others.

Or maybe Ji Tai was waiting for an opportunity.

The prince's brother died in the Kyoto Incident last year. He left Yanyunguan with 30,000 elites...

This is a capital crime of treason!

But he still did it.

Just to avenge the prince brother.

He believed that Li Chen'an benefited the most from the incident in Kyoto. He believed that the prince's brother died in Li Chen'an's hands...or died because of Li Chen'an.

He believed that the culprit was Li Chenan, so after he heard that Li Chenan was going to Shuzhou via Jiangnan, he led his troops there without hesitation.

Did he do something wrong?

If we look at it from the perspective of national justice, if Huang Ren seizes that first-line opportunity and really captures Yanyunguan... he will bear the infamy for eternity!

But if you look at it from the perspective of a domestic slave's loyalty to his master, he has undoubtedly fulfilled his duty of loyalty.

He kept the promise he made to his mother and the prince's brother, even if he suffered a lifetime of infamy.

Ning Chuchu took a deep breath and her tone became softer.

"Do you regret it?"

Xia Houzhuo grinned and shook his head: "I have never regretted it."

"When the news of His Royal Highness's death reached the northern frontier army, I closed my door and thought about it for three days."

"His Royal Highness the Prince is a kindhearted man, how could he be killed?"

“Why can’t good people live long lives?”

"He is the crown prince of our Ning Kingdom!"

"In the future, he will be the emperor of our Ning Kingdom!"

"He ascended the throne and became the emperor, and many ministers were able to die a good death. Even if Jita did this to him... His Highness the Crown Prince did not have the intention to kill him."

"But those ministers couldn't tolerate him!"

Xia Houzhuo turned to look at Li Chenan, "Even if you want to steal the country, His Royal Highness the Crown Prince said in his letter to me that he regards you as a confidant... It doesn't matter whether you become the regent or you ascend the throne and become the emperor... kill a human or animal.

A harmless prince, or a prince who treats you as a friend...are you feeling complacent?"

Li Chenan sighed slightly, looked at Xia Houzhuo, and said very sincerely:

"If I say that I have never wanted to kill His Highness the Crown Prince, would you believe it?"

Do you believe it?

How could Xia Houzhuo believe it?

Since ancient times, it has been extremely normal for brothers to kill each other for the dragon chair, not to mention that Li Chenan is still an outsider!

If he, Li Chenan, wants to hold on to that power, he will definitely kill the orthodox Crown Prince.

This is not some conspiracy thought, this is the most normal thing!

Xia Houzhuo laughed at himself: "If you win, you can say whatever you want. If I lose, I will be convinced if I lose!"

"I never expected that old guy Xi Wei would dig a huge hole in front of me and let me jump into it willingly..."

"If it weren't for Xi Wei's persuasion, I wouldn't have cooperated with Xie Jing at all."

"I'll hold!"

"Wait until your people start fighting with Xie Jing's people."

"I have plenty of time to wait, because you have to go to Shuzhou, and I... don't have to go to Kyoto!"

"I will wait until the result of the battle between your thousands of people and Xie Jing, so as to observe the combat effectiveness of your thousands of people...or I will wait until the ambush you laid appears."

"But that old guy Xi Wei lied to me!"

"If it weren't for him, even if I were defeated, I could have gone away and waited for another chance."

Li Chenan was slightly startled. He didn't expect that Xi Wei had done a lot of things behind his back for this matter.

He looked at Xiao Baozi, then turned to look at Xia Houzhuo. Instead of asking what Xi Wei had persuaded him, he talked about something that surprised Xia Houzhuo:

"Do you know why I didn't ascend the throne as emperor?"

"Because I don't have much interest in that stuff."

"Before the incident in Kyoto, His Royal Highness came to visit the plum garden where I live."

"It was autumn, and of course the plum blossoms were not in bloom, but we chatted for a long time in the plum garden."

"I also think he is a very good prince and will become a very good emperor in the future. As for being soft-hearted... He can be soft-hearted. I originally wanted to help him become a villain."

"Whatever he can't make up his mind to do, I will do it."

"I will lift the knife that he cannot lift."

"I will kill those who he can't bear to kill...some people must be killed, otherwise there will be big problems in Ning Guo. I think you should know this too."

"He is too fat, which is not good for his health. I even made a weight loss plan for him."

"It's just that I didn't expect that the changes in Kyoto would come so quickly, nor did I expect that the people who attacked him would be so decisive."

"He did not die because of the death of the late emperor, he was indeed murdered!"

Xia Houzhuo never expected that Li Chenan did not deny the cause of His Royal Highness the Crown Prince's death. His pupils shrank:

"Who harmed His Highness?"

"I don't know. I may investigate it, or I may not care about it... The deceased is gone, and I still have a lot to do."

"You...you want to avenge him. That's understandable. You left Yanyunguan without authorization. This is a capital crime!"

"No one can save you."
